        Pre calculus is a branch of mathematics that deals with the study of functions, graphs, and limits. It serves as a bridge between algebra and calculus, introducing students to advanced mathematical concepts such as derivatives, integrals, and trigonometry. By understanding pre calculus, students develop problem-solving skills, critical thinking, and analytical reasoning – essential skills for success in math and science fields.

      • Pre calculus is a precursor to calculus, introducing students to fundamental concepts and skills necessary for calculus. While pre calculus focuses on the study of functions, graphs, and limits, calculus builds upon these concepts, exploring the study of rates of change and accumulation.

      The US education system places a strong emphasis on math and science education, making pre calculus a vital subject for students seeking to pursue STEM fields (science, technology, engineering, and mathematics). As the job market continues to shift towards tech and data-driven industries, employers are seeking candidates with strong math and problem-solving skills. This increasing demand has led to a greater focus on pre calculus education, with many institutions and organizations working to improve math literacy and address common challenges.
